Latest Patents

Among Satoh's latest patents is a groundbreaking composition aimed at the treatment or prevention of age-related macular degeneration (AMD). This innovative formulation uses molecular hydrogen as an active ingredient, representing a novel approach to combating this vision-affecting condition. The application outlines a method for administering the composition to subjects diagnosed with AMD, showcasing the potential for molecular hydrogen in restoring or maintaining vision.

Another noteworthy invention is a sophisticated hydrogen gas generator designed for efficient hydrogen production. This device encompasses an electrolyzer with various components, including a housing, chambers, a membrane, and electrode plates. The generator operates by electrolyzing water while featuring a diluter to introduce a diluent gas, enabling precise control over hydrogen gas concentration.
